Output a8e04e571523b92586b29bc2fec6e95051967bd13d8a8f20c7e8f66f5e7fabe8:5

value
2666423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86679717c3a5a735d67f56db37bb5827cb0fe23 OP_EQUAL
address
3MREe2NPyQbBqj4QWNxQwqu4cf5VLteB9N
transaction
a8e04e571523b92586b29bc2fec6e95051967bd13d8a8f20c7e8f66f5e7fabe8
confirmations
327354
spent
true